BAHAMIAN JOHNNY CAKE



Bahamian Johnny Cake image

After a trip to the Bahamas, my mom came home with a recipe for something call Johnny Cake which is completely unlike U.S. Johnny Cake (usually a version of cornbread). It is a great big baking powder biscuit traditionally cooked on the stove top in cast iron pan. It always takes us all back to Spanish Wells, Bahamas to make...

Categories     Biscuits

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 6

3 c flour
1 Tbsp baking powder
1 tsp salt
1/4 c white sugar
1/2 c butter
2/3 c milk

Steps:

  • 1. Combine dry ingredients and cut in the butter until pea sized. Add milk to make a soft dough and knead until smooth. Let dough rest for about 10 minutes.
  • 2. You can use either of these cooking methods: Heat a cast iron skillet on very low to medium low heat on the stove top and grease well. Roll out the dough into a disk that neatly fits in the pan. Grill on each side about 10-15 minutes being careful not to burn it. Flipping it is a challenge. I used 2 spatulas in tandem. Check for doneness and cut into wedges and eat. This is how they do it in the Bahamas.
  • 3. OR place the dough in a greased 8 or 9 inch round or square pan. Pierce the top with a fork and bake at 350 for 20-25 minutes. Remove from oven and brush with milk, return to oven and bake for 5 minutes more. Then EAT IT.

JOHNNY CAKES (THE BAHAMAS)



Johnny Cakes (The Bahamas) image

This recipe Is from week 19 of my food blog, "Travel by Stove." I am attempting to cook one meal from every nation on Earth, and The Bahamas are my 19th stop. Johnny cakes are served all over the Caribbean, but they make them a little differently in the Bahamas (without cornmeal).

Categories     Breads

Time 45m

Yield 9-12 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

3 cups flour
1 tablespoon ba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up sugar
1/2 cup shortening
2/3 cup whole milk

Steps:

  • Mix all the dry ingredients together, then cut in the shortening. Work the mixture with your hands until the grains are about the size of rice.
  • Add milk until you get a soft dough (I had to use a bit more than the recipe called for).
  • Turn out onto a floured surface and knead until smooth.
  • Let the dough rest for 10 minutes, then transfer it to a greased 9x9 inch pan. You will have to press it down so it fills in all the corners. Poke the top of the dough a few times with a fork.
  • Bake at 350 degrees for 20 to 25 minutes. You can tell the cake is done when it starts to turn a little golden around the edges.

BAHAMA VACATION JOHNNY CAKE



Bahama Vacation Johnny Cake image

On a recent vacation to the Bahamas with my daughter, we were served Johnny Cake with dinner instead of the usual bread or rolls. It's light, slightly sweet, and was served warm. We've made it for breakfast and there's never any left. It's great with butter or jam.

Categories     Breads

Time 30m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 1/2 cups fl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
2 eggs
1 (14 ounce) can sweetened condensed milk
4 tablespoons vegetable oil

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350.
  • Lightly butter an 8-inch square or round cake pan.
  • Whisk together flour and baking powder for a moment to aerate.
  • Mix eggs, milk, and oil well. Stir into dry ingredients, mixing well. Pour into prepared pan and bake for 20-30 minutes or until top is golden brown. Brush crust with melted butter. Slice into wedges or squares, serve warm, and enjoy!

BAHAMIAN JOHNNY BREAD



Bahamian Johnny Bread image

This recipe is a cultural staple in the Bahamas and throughout the Caribbean and is a family favorite(one which I have tweaked a bit over the years to suit various tastebuds) but its a wonderful bread/cake-like dish thats commonly served with soups and souses of all kinds (for breakfast, lunch or dinner)and can also be wonderful after dinner supper topped with jam and served with tea or cocoa. My family especially loves to eat it like a sandwich with cheese or peanut butter in the middle.Yum...the choices are endless. Hope you enjoy!!!!

Categories     Quick Breads

Time 55m

Yield 12-16 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

6 cups all-purpose flour
3/4 cup sugar
6 tablespoons ba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up unsalted butter
2 cups low-fat milk
1 cup water
4 whole eggs
1/4 cup vegetable oil
1/4 cup melted butter

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ees and grease an 11x15 baking pan and set aside.
  • In a mixing bowl, sift together the flour and baking powder and then add the sugar and salt. With your fingers, gently knead in the stick of butter until well incorporated in the mixture. Add in the eggs, vegetable oil, milk and water and mix well with a spoon until the texture of your mixture is between that of a bread dough and the batter of a cake mix, adding more water if necessary.
  • Pour mixture into greased pan and bake for 30mins. Brush the melted butter over the top and continue to bake for another 15 mins or until golden brown and butter knife comes out clean from the middle.
  • Cut in squares and serve warm with butter or jam.

BAHAMIAN BAKED JOHNNY CAKE



Bahamian Baked Johnny Cake image

In some regions, "johnny cakes" are small, flat griddle cakes. In The Bahamas, Johnny Cake is baked. Serve your Johnny Cake warm with butter or jam as a breakfast treat or a snack, or enjoy it as a side dish with stew or soups. Recipe is from a Facebook group.

Categories     Breads

Time 1h8m

Yield 9 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1/2 cup butter, plus extra for greasing pan
3/4 cup sugar
4 cups flour
1/2 cup water
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 teaspoons baking powder
3/4 cup milk

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ees.
  • With an electric mixer, mix the butter and sugar together until combined.
  • Add the flour, water, salt, and baking powder to the bowl. Combine.
  • Add the milk slowly until the batter is sticky.
  • Dust hands with flour. Transfer dough from bowl to greased 9x9 pan. Gently flatten the dough in the pan.
  • Bake for 1 hr or until the edges of the johnny cake are browned. The johnny cake will not rise much. (Every stove is different so while it's baking, keep an eye for the golden edges).
